To write a strong application for college senior scholarships, be clear and concise, tailor your essays to each scholarship, highlight your unique experiences, and proofread your application for errors.
To apply for college senior scholarships, you typically need to complete an application form, provide transcripts, and submit any required essays or letters of recommendation. Check the specific requirements for each scholarship.
Eligibility criteria for college senior scholarships can vary widely but often include being a current college senior, maintaining a certain GPA, and demonstrating financial need or academic merit.
In your personal statement for college senior scholarships, include your academic achievements, career goals, relevant experiences, and why you are a strong candidate for the scholarship.
While many college senior scholarships do require a minimum GPA, there are also scholarships available that consider other factors such as community service, leadership, or financial need.
